## Runbook: Slow template renders on Quillgate

If render times on Quillgate creep past 400ms, it's almost always the partial cache getting evicted too aggressively. Don't restart the workers first — bump the cache TTL and watch the p95 for ten minutes. Ping whoever's on release duty before touching prod. The current rendering config we ship with is as follows.

config for kafof-bawef:
holath:
  log_level: debug
  metrics_host: metrics.holath.qorvelsys.internal
  pin: 2191
  pool_size: 32

**Q2 Planning — Harwick Basin Expansion**

We open in the Harwick Basin region next quarter. Two branch sites confirmed; a third under lease review. Sales leads: build territory lists now, prioritise distributors already carrying the Fennix line. Quotas for the new region land with April targets. Travel budget approved for scouting visits; route requests through Odo Brask. No external communication until launch. The strategic context appears in the note below.

confidential, kagep-kahof: Druokax Systems plans to lower the Ulaath list price by 53 percent in March.

**Mgmt Meeting Minutes — Retiring the Brightline Range**

Quick recap for sales leads at Fenholt Supplies: we agreed to retire the Brightline fixture range by year-end. Remaining stock moves to clearance pricing next month, and accounts on standing orders get migrated to the Lumetta range. Trade-in incentives were approved in principle. The confidential note on next steps sits just below.

board note of bajof-bajeg: The pricing group signed off on a budget of $13.4 million for Project Sildor. The renewal with Lamixek Holdings closes at $48.9 million a year, 49 percent above the last contract.

## Service Accounts: Pinwheel Cache Postmortem

Context for the weekly sync: the stale-cache incident traced back to the `svc-pinwheel-refresh` account losing write access to the invalidation topic after the Q3 permissions sweep. Caches served day-old pricing for six hours. Fix: the refresh job now fails loudly on publish errors instead of swallowing them, and ownership moved to the Lanternfish team. The account was rebuilt from scratch; old credentials are revoked. It now authenticates to the internal invalidation broker with the key below.

API key for tagug-tajef: vxb4-R1fo